There is no direct connection from Bude to Portreath. However, you can take the taxi to Bodmin Parkway, take the train to Redruth, walk to Railway Station, then take the line 49 bus to Tregea Terrace. Alternatively, you can drive from Bude to Portreath in around 1h 14m.
